Punjab News of Punjab Kapurthala (Kapurthala) About 100 slums built near the train coach factory caught fire. As the flames intensified, the slums were burnt to ashes. Although there was no loss of life, the slums were completely burnt to ashes. As soon as the fire was reported, the vehicles of the fire brigade and the police administration reached the spot and saved the lives and property of the people. Let us tell you that last year also the slums caught fire and the goods got burnt.
